Abstract

A copper bioleaching process which makes use of a consortium which contains Leptospirillum ferriphilum and a sulphur oxidising microorganism which is halophilic or halotolerant.

Claims (16)

1. A method of treating a sulphide mineral or mixed sulphide and oxide mineral comprising bioleaching the mineral in a chloride ion solution with a mixed culture consortium wherein:

a) the chloride ion content is in the range of about 5,000 ppm to about 30,000 ppm;

b) the chloride ion solution contains at least one of the following:

aluminium, magnesium and sodium;

c) the temperature of the solution is in excess of about 10° C.;

d) the pH of the solution is in the range of about 1 to about 3; and

e) the mixed culture consortium contains at least a salt tolerant strain of Leptospirillum ferriphilum which is strain Sp-Cl deposited at the DSMZ under the accession number DSM22399, and a sulphur oxidising microorganism which is halophilic or halotolerant, which consortium enhances the rate of ferrous iron oxidation.

2. A method according to claim 1 wherein the temperature is in the range of about 25° C. to about 45° C.

3. A method according to claim 1 wherein at least one microorganism in the consortium is cultured in at least one build-up reactor.

4. A method according to claim 1 wherein the mineral is inoculated with an inoculant which has a cell concentration of the consortium of between about 10 7 cells/ml and about 10 9 cells/ml to maintain a cell count in the mineral of from about 10 6 to about 10 11 cells per ton of ore.

5. A method according to claim 3 wherein an inoculum from the reactor is directed to a pond which is aerated and in which the inoculum is stored and maintained, and inoculum from the pond is added to the mineral.

6. A method according to claim 3 wherein inoculum from the reactor is added to crushed ore together with acid to form inoculated ore that is added to the mineral.

7. A method according to claim 1 wherein the consortium is produced in an inoculum generator and ore, to which microorganisms of the consortium is attached, is added to the mineral.

8. A method according to claim 1 wherein the sulphide mineral or the mixed sulphide and oxide mineral includes copper and wherein the method further comprises: extracting an intermediate leach solution from the mineral wherein the intermediate leach solution is not subjected to a metal recovery process, passing a pregnant leach solution draining from the mineral through a metal recovery process to define a raffinate and recirculating the intermediate leach solution and the raffinate to the mineral to increase the active cell count in the mineral.

9. A method according to claim 1 wherein sulphide mineral or the mixed sulphide and oxide mineral includes copper and wherein the microorganisms in the consortium have a tolerance to copper in excess of about 0.5 g/l.

10. A method according to claim 1 wherein at least one of the microorganisms included in the mixed culture consortium is adapted to increase tolerance of the consortium to chloride and to copper.
